资源简介:
In April-May 2023, the SUPERBIT telescope was lifted to the Earth’s stratosphere by a 1 helium-filled superpressure balloon, to acquire astronomical imaging from above (99.7% of) the 2 Earth’s atmosphere. It was launched from New Zealand then, for 40 days, circumnavigated the 3 globe five times at a latitude 40-50 degrees South. Attached to the telescope were four “DRS” (Data 4 Recovery System) capsules containing 5TB solid state data storage, plus a GNSS receiver, Iridium 5 transmitter, and parachute. Data from the telescope were copied to these, and two were dropped 6 over Argentina. They drifted 61km horizontally while they descended 32 km, but we predicted their 7 descent vectors within 2.4 km: in this location, the discrepancy appears irreducible below ∼2km 8 because of high wind speeds and small-scale variations in wind and topography. The capsules then 9 reported their own locations to within a few metres. We recovered the capsules and successfully 10 retrieved all of SUPERBIT’s data—despite the telescope itself being later destroyed on landing.
